About Morton Amphitheater

Morton Amphitheater is located at 1 Riverboat Drive, Riverside, MO 64150, as part of the Argosy Casino Hotel and Spa complex. The amphitheater features a covered pavilion with reserved seating and a spacious general admission lawn section, combining for a total capacity of roughly 15,000. The venue's position along the Missouri River gives it a natural backdrop, and the hillside lawn provides good sight lines even from the back rows.

The Argosy Casino complex surrounding the amphitheater adds a resort-style dimension to the concert experience. Concertgoers can access the casino, hotel, and multiple restaurants on property, making it easy to build a full evening or weekend around the show. The venue's proximity to Interstate 635 and Interstate 29 provides straightforward access from anywhere in the Kansas City metro area.

Mumford & Sons and the Prizefighter Album

The Prizefighter Tour takes its name from Mumford & Sons' sixth album, produced alongside Aaron Dessner of The National. The record marks an evolution in the band's sound, layering atmospheric production over their folk-rock foundations and incorporating collaborations with Hozier, Chris Stapleton, Gracie Abrams, Justin Vernon, and Gigi Perez. Kansas City: Barbecue, Jazz, and Beyond

Kansas City needs no introduction when it comes to food and music. The city's barbecue tradition is among the most celebrated in the country, with iconic establishments like Joe's Kansas City, Q39, Gates BBQ, and Jack Stack Barbecue drawing pilgrims from across the nation. A pre-show barbecue stop is practically a requirement for any visit.

The city's jazz heritage runs deep as well. The 18th and Vine District is home to the American Jazz Museum and a collection of live jazz clubs that keep the tradition alive. The Power & Light District downtown offers a more modern entertainment experience with restaurants, bars, and live entertainment concentrated in a pedestrian-friendly zone. For sports fans, Arrowhead Stadium and Kauffman Stadium are both in the Truman Sports Complex, and the Kansas City Current's new stadium on the riverfront has added to the city's growing event infrastructure.

Making the Most of Kansas City

A concert at Morton Amphitheater is a perfect excuse to explore what Kansas City has to offer. The City Market in the River Market neighborhood is one of the oldest and largest public farmers' markets in the Midwest, with local produce, artisan goods, and diverse food stalls. The Nelson-Atkins Museum of Art features an encyclopedic collection in a stunning building with the famous Shuttlecocks sculpture on the lawn — and admission is free.

For nightlife, the Crossroads Arts District has emerged as KC's creative hub, with galleries, breweries, restaurants, and live music venues clustered south of downtown. First Fridays art walks draw thousands to the neighborhood monthly. The Westport entertainment district offers another concentration of bars and restaurants with a more established, neighborhood-pub feel.
